ABSTRACT:
Two printed circuit boards are provided, each having a row of metallic pads located along an edge. The pads are spaced along the edge so that, when the boards are aligned with the two edges opposing each other, every pad in the row of one board is opposite a pad of the row of the opposing board. Each pad has a drilled center hole suitable for the insertion of a wire. The boards are opposed and spaced apart, and jumper wires are inserted to connect each pair of opposing pad holes. The jumper wires are inserted into the holes from the opposite sides of the pads and the ends of the jumpers are soldered to the pads. The jumper wires are then cut at points intermediate the two boards to provide a row of conductive mounting terminals along an edge of each board.
